Why pick GotG?
There's A LOT of reasons I picked Guardians of the Galaxy as my NuStar title. First off, I love the team! Rocket's one my favorite characters in comics, maybe even in literature, and I enjoy the damaged nature of each of the team members. DnA's run is one of my favorites in all comic history, up there with BMB's Ultimate Spider-Man, Miller's Daredevil, Millar's Ultimates, Snyder's Batman, Johns' Flash and more. I think it's evident how cool the characters are by how popular the movie is. After all, it wasn't the plot or villain that drove the sales through the roof.
Second, I really wanted a challenge in more ways than one. I knew the movie was coming out and that would affect people's expectations of the title if only because it was their only experience with the characters. I welcomed that, and decided if I could just make people enjoy my story, and have fun reading it then I'd done my job well. The other challenge was that I'd never written anything in the middle of space, far away from Earth, and filled with so much alien frag that I literally have to plan all the culture, languages, etc. out in advance. It's been tough, and I've discovered I'm not as good at it as I am at maintaining an Earth-based title, but it's been a lot of fun.
Lastly, I really wanted to write Thanos. Like, really really really wanted to. I needed him for my plans, and boy, will I use him!

Why pick T-Bolts?
Red Hulk, Ghost Rider, the Punisher, Deadpool, and Red She-Hulk. This cast of characters just screams awesome. Seriously. These guys are the baddest asses of the Marvel Universe in my opinion. Writing these guys in a team would be a dream come true to anyone.
While writing, I knew GR, Punisher, and DP wouldn't just join out of the goodness of their hearts. They had to have some selfish reason to join. Trust me, these are selfish characters. So, General Ross manipulates their selfishness into making them join. GR has no purpose in his life, but being on the team gives him a life to live. All DP wants is fame and money, and being on the team will definitely give him that. Punisher was tricky. Originally I had decided that he'd join simply because it'd let him kill more people. That's still part of the reason, but I decided that I'd have the General threaten Frank into joining.
The point of this title is family. These characters have lost everything: Ghost Rider his soul, DP is sanity, and Punisher his family. These are characters burdened with loss. And yet, through each other, they grow stronger.
